tapping the squid


“tapping the squid” – v. – to partake in the ingestion of a downer in combination with the consumption of alcohol to promote a blackout. frequently the “squid” (as it is called) takes the form of a muscle relaxer or a pain killer. this term was popularized by episode 11 of the second season of the popular show “huff” when the main character was asked to drink a mysterious blue drink (which was derived from the aquatic animal) and ended up hallucinating wildly in the back room of the establishment with a “lady of the night”
“hey fellas, i’m bored, i think it’s time to start tapping the squid.”
“are you sure that is a good idea? last time we broke out the squids, you ended up with a gap-toothed ghetto hag”

Read Also:

  • tarrissa

    an extremly beautiful smart girl that when you see her it makes the rest of your day amazing. they go through lots of tragic experiences in their life so they have been through a lot and are the strongest girls you will meet. they are so amazing you wish you were lucky enough to call […]

  • Taser Crazy

    when you are having s-x and your partner is being less than energetic in bed, so you taser their -ss and let them start doing most of the work. “hey nicole how was s-x last night?” ” it started out pretty sh-tty, he was acting like he was half dead so i went taser crazy […]

  • Teegtahn

    a word from the d’ni language from the games of myst, riven, exile, uru. it translates to worker, literally teeg being ‘work’ and tahn being an agent noun suffix. example sentance: tehsot prin fahehts teegtahntee kodoteegeet defination: our first small group (of) workers were working

  • te la comes

    a short way to say you suck d-ck in spanish my friend: heyy duuuuude whast up?! me:te la comes, dude you gotta let me sleep

  • Textual Revolution

    the textual revolution encomp-sses the changes in social thought and codes of behavior related to communication throughout the western world. it began to flourish wildly during the 00’s, and is still ongoing. it primarily involves the m-ss migration of communication from the already impersonal phone call, to the infinitely more detached and disposable text message. […]


Disclaimer: tapping the squid definition / meaning should not be considered complete, up to date, and is not intended to be used in place of a visit, consultation, or advice of a legal, medical, or any other professional. All content on this website is for informational purposes only.